Garlic Butter Beef Pasta Dish

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ings 4 servings
Calories 650
A flavorful and hearty pasta dish featuring tender ground beef, garlic, and Parmesan cheese in a savory butter sauce.

Ingredients

Pasta

  • 12 ounces short-cut pasta such as shells, penne, or rotini

Dairy

  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ese (finely shredded by hand)

Meat

  • 1 pound lean ground beef

Broth & Seasonings

  • 1 cup low-sodium beef broth
  • 1/2 teaspoon Italian herb blend
  • 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t (or more to preference)

Garlic

  • 4 cloves fresh garlic cloves (minced finely)

Garnish

  • Optional chopped flat-leaf parsley (for garnish)

Instructions 

  • Bring a large salted water to a boil, cook pasta until tender, then drain.
  • Cook ground beef in a skillet until browned; drain excess grease.
  • Add butter and minced garlic; cook 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
  • Mix in pasta, beef broth, herbs, salt, and pepper; toss to coat.
  • Stir in Parmesan cheese; simmer 2-3 minutes until sauce thickens. Garnish with parsley if desired.

Notes

For extra flavor, sprinkle with additional Parmesan or fresh herbs before serving.
